Stephen R. Couples - Confirmed reviews ALL

As always (we have stayed here at least 10 times in last couple of years) the hotel staff and staff on duty for breakfast are excellent, without fault. However, the Management of the restaurant in the evening (not the waiting staff) is poor. As hotel guests, when we stop at all other Accor venues across Europe, we are able to reserve a table for dinner after what can sometimes be a long and tiring day. That is not the case at Novotel London Bridge and on the previous 3 occasions now we have been treated no differently from anyone who simply walks in off the street. Most recently we checked in at around 630pm and sought to reserve a table for 7pm to allow us to check in, drop bags and freshen up - not unreasonable. We were told that we could not reserve a table but that it was not necessary either as we could be accommodated for dinner when we were due to return at 7pm. Surprise, surprise, when we returned to the restaurant at 7pm the only seating offered to us was low level coffee tables where any plate would be at below knee level, hardly conducive to eating dinnner? We explained our disappointment as this was not really suitable nor in line with what we had been told 1/2 an hour before. We explained that this was not the first time and asked if we could kindly sit at one of the tables in the rear section of the restaurant where we have sat previously? The waiter checked with the Manager and returned to tell us that was unfortunately not possible as the desire on the part of Management was to fill the low level seating area first. I would for the record note that there were at this time only 3 tables out of perhaps 12 or more that were not occupied in the bar area. We pleasantly stuck to our guns and were offered seats for 3 people at a high level 8 person table which was acceptable but not particularly comfortable. Within 5 minutes of our sitting down a party of 4 people came in from the street and after a brief chat were shown to a table in the rear of the restaurant where we had pleasantly asked if we could sit only moments before. After a further 10 minutes and no approach to take a drinks order from us, another party of 4 people entered off the street and were immediately offered seating to the rear of the restaurant. We pleasantly asked if we could order drinks and also speak to a Manager. The drinks order was taken and within a couple of minutes the Manager came to our table to ask whether there was a problem. The Manager was fully aware of the issue from the outset having seen us identified by the waiter when asked earlier where he could sit us for dinner. The Manager then explained policy of 1) not taking reservations and 2) seeking to fill up the low level seating area first. Unfortunately that did not hold water as when the 2 x 4 person walk-in parties entered after ourselves, there were still 3 tables available in the low seat area, each of which had 4 to 6 seats available. But they were immediately without delay shown to tables in the back area of the restaurant. When it came to settling our bill I had yet to utilise our complimentary Gold Member Drinks vouchers but noted that three of the 4 drinks we consumed during the meal had been provided to us free of charge as a gesture of “good will”. I then used the voucher to cover the 4th drink. The gesture of offering free drinks, although appreciated did not really serve to rectify what I trust you agree to be frustration on our part at simply being fobbed off and then seeing subsequent clients offered without delay something that we were pointedly refused and this is not the first time this has happened to us or we have seen it happen to other hotel guests. The restaurant staff are all generally very good, but on occasion the restaurant management seem to almost shy away from filling tables and appear to be restricting how many covers they accept, unfortunately this is really not good practice and damaging to your overall brand appearance.

Valerie D. Families - Confirmed reviews ALL

Thumbs up for the quiet rooms and convenient location next to borough market with lots of buses and underground access nearby. A few remarks though … staff is quiet unfriendly except for reception The common facilities aren’t very clean … especially toilets in lobby.:( … Disappointing for a 4* hotel. Same for bathroom in rooms. We had a suite on the 4th floor… without a real bathroom, just a shower in a corner and separate we, therefore it’s cold when u come out of the shower and not suitable for families. The quality /price ratio isn’t good
